Playground Rules

Playground Rules and Safety

The playground is intended to be a fun, safe, social, stimulating environment for children. For safety reasons:

  • No food or drink is allowed on the playground unless the beverage has a lid (for adults only).  Please keep hot beverages out of reach of children.
  • No toys from home are allowed.
  • Keep the entry and snack room gates closed at all times.
  • No sick children/adults (see below).
  • Soiled/wet diapers are to be taken outside of the building (do not leave in garbage cans).
  • No unsupervised children are allowed in the toy storage room.
  • Supervise all children at all times. This includes in the snack room, the bathroom and the hallway for a drink of water.
  • Toys are cleaned with non-toxic cleaning products.
  • Parents may take out and put away toys from the toy storage room at their discretion during hours of operation.
  • If you notice any toy is broken or in some way hazardous, please put it away in the toy room and report the issue to the Site Manager, either via email or by writing a note on the whiteboard in the toy room.

 

Sick Policy

Please keep you and your child home if family members have any of the following symptoms within 24 hours prior to visiting the playground:

  • Diarrhea
  • Fever of 100 degrees or higher
  • Heavy cough/croup
  • Sore throat/swollen glands
  • Vomiting or nausea
  • Pinkish appearance in the eye, especially with discharge
  • Rash
  • Runny nose, especially green or yellow in color
In addition, if you were at the playground and then experience a serious or contagious illness, please contact a Board Member so we may notify other members that were at the playground that day to warn them of any symptoms their child may experience (i.e., pink eye).
